Itinerario
Llegue a Chichén Itzá con las ruinas recién abiertas para disfrutar de una visita guiada completa de 2 horas de duración. Conozca el antiguo Chichén Itzá donde se encuentran los edificios como La Iglesia, Las Monjas, El Observatorio y vea 1 de los 2 cenotes dentro de las ruinas. Tome fotografías increíbles en el castillo de Kukukkan sin multitudes y disfrute de un fantástico paseo para conocer la historia del Castillo de Kukulkán, el Templo de las 1000 Columnas, el Templo del Jaguar y el estadio de juego de pelota más grande de la cultura maya. El tiempo total en Chichén Itzá es de 2 horas y media. 1 hora 45 minutos de visita guiada y 45 minutos de tiempo libre para tomar fotografías, explorar usted mismo el sitio o comprar recuerdos donde usted elija dentro de las ruinas.
Descubra uno de los cenotes subterráneos más impresionantes de Yucatán, el Cenote Hubiku, donde podrá darse un refrescante baño bajo cientos de estalactitas después de visitar las ruinas de Chichén Itzá. Después de nadar, disfrutará de un almuerzo buffet regional en el restaurante Cenote.
A continuación, visite Ek Balam, un sitio arqueológico maya yucateco fuera de lo común con increíbles tallas escondidas en un paisaje selvático. Sube a la altísima pirámide de la Acrópolis, el punto más alto de las ruinas.
